My sister has a TF 3.0 Automatic, everytime she pull up and stop the revs go up and down from about 1200 to almost 0 and then stalls. It was doing it occassionally, but now it is doing it everytime it stops, sometimes it stalls as soon as she has stopped other times the revs jump and down a couple times and then it stalls. It starts again fine but then will stall again. Does anyone have any ideas what it could be. Thanks.

Check your air cleaner and for any vacuum leaks - just check all of those hoses leading to/from the throttle body are well connected and free of cracks/breaks.

Clean the throttle body - pretty sure there's a guide here. Just get some carby/throttle body cleaner and go at it. I pull the idle speed control motor out to clean mine. After that clean the MAF with some contact cleaner. I also clean the hose between the MAF and throttle body to.

So far the grand total for this would be around $30, add $35 if you needed a new air cleaner.

If its still doing it I'd be checking the Idles Speed Control motor. Simple check is the screwdriver stethoscope trick, if its not "whirring" away at idle its probably dead. That'll cost you - $100 minimum or a trip to the wreckers.

If its STILL doing it... and you're 100% sure you have no vacuum leaks I'd do a compression test. and drag it down to somebody with the right diagnostics to check its not a temperature sensor, O2 sensor or something fruity elsewhere.
